Taking care of "lavatory logistics," the just-launched Airpnp app lets "entrepeeneurs" rent out their bathrooms to people searching for a place to use the facilities. Those who want to put their toilet on the rental market provide their address and pictures of their bathroom. Those looking for a place to pee can then find bathrooms in their area and rate their experience (toilet paper quality and cleanliness of the loo, for example). True story: peeing in public is one of the quickest ways to end up in the clinker during Mardi Gras season, and surely Airpnp's creators, New Orleans natives Max Gaudin and Travis Laurendine, had that in mind. No word yet on the exact cost or how quickly the "entrepeeneurs" will tire of drunks tromping through their homes, but the last count shows that 1,450 people have signed up already.
